  • Drummer Shannon Larkin of Godsmack talks his journey of playing drums since the age of 8, hearing loss, Godsmack’s new studio in Nashville, the full circle of playing in his Dad’s garage to playing in his garage as an adult, the stage production and double drum mobile-risers of Godsmack’s live show and the bizarre timing of the call for him to join Godsmack, work with Ugly Kid Joe, Amen, Glassjaw & more, the spectrum of music played in his house and how his sister turned him on to Rush & Zeppelin, K-tel record compilations, how a broken collar bone lead to some of his showmanship that continues to this day, & more!!!
